Where Spring Begins: The 2026 La Conner Daffodil Festival

Spring returns to the Skagit Valley in spectacular fashion with the 2026 La Conner Daffodil Festival, a celebration of bright blooms, local creativity, and the slower rhythms that make this season so special. This year’s official festival poster features a stunning photograph by Sarah Walls, winner of the 2025 La Conner Daffodil Festival Photography Contest. Her image captures the quiet magic of daffodils stretching toward the light—a fitting visual invitation to another unforgettable spring in La Conner.

As always, planning ahead is key. Lodging fills up quickly during daffodil season, so booking early is highly recommended whether you’re planning a weekend getaway or a midweek escape. Because bloom timing varies with weather, visitors are encouraged to keep an eye on the Daffodil Bloom Map, which provides up-to-date information on which fields are blooming and when. It’s the best way to time your visit for peak color and to explore the valley responsibly and respectfully.

New for 2026, the festival is welcoming an exciting addition to its lineup of experiences. Tulip Valley Farms, home of the World’s Most Scenic U-Pick Tulip Experience, is joining the La Conner Daffodil Festival as the festival’s only Daffodil U-Pick experience. Throughout March, visitors will be invited directly into the fields to hand-pick their own daffodils—an experience that blends beauty, simplicity, and connection to the land.

As the West Coast’s largest U-Pick tulip farm, Tulip Valley Farms offers expansive grassy walkways, a relaxed, park-like setting, and plenty of space to wander, photograph, and linger. The farm is especially family-friendly, making it an ideal stop for spring outings and memory-making. Adding to the charm, the beloved micro mini Highland cows from Compact Cattle Co. will be returning, including a new calf—a sure highlight for visitors of all ages.
